概括
唾液腺组织的自然杀手 (trNK) 细胞来自传统的NK (cNK) 细胞,而不是ILC1细胞. TGF-β和IL-15信号传递促进它们的组织存在和细胞毒性功能.

背景情况:
- 自然杀手 (NK) 细胞在免疫监测和组织平衡中起着至关重要的作用.
- 组织内 NK 细胞的确切起源和发育途径尚不完全理解.
- 唾液腺代表着一个独特的免疫微环境,其中存在着固有的免疫细胞群.
研究的目的:
- 阐明唾液腺组织居民NK细胞 (trNK) 的发育起源.
- 为了区分trNK细胞与其他先天性淋巴细胞,特别是1型先天性淋巴细胞 (ILC1).
- 确定驱动trNK细胞组织居住和功能的关键分子机制.
主要方法:
- 流细胞测量和单细胞RNA测序以表征免疫细胞群.
- 在体内研究使用小鼠模型来追踪细胞发育和居住期.
- 试验室试验用于研究细胞因子信号通路 (TGF-β,IL-15) 以及它们对细胞功能的影响.
主要成果:
- 唾液腺trNK细胞显然来源于传统的NK (cNK) 细胞.
- 在发育上,trNK细胞与ILC1细胞有所区别,支持独特的血统.
- 连续的自克林转化生长因子-β (TGF-β) 信号传递对于唾液腺组织的存在至关重要.
- 介质素-15 (IL-15) 与TGF-β协同作用,增强trNK细胞中的霍比特依赖性细胞毒性.
结论:
- 唾液腺的trNK细胞从cNK细胞中产生,建立了一个与ILC1s独立的独特血统.
- 自克林TGF-β信号传递是trNK细胞组织在唾液腺中存在的关键驱动因素.
- 结合的TGF-β和IL-15信号通路调节唾液腺trNK细胞的细胞毒性潜力.

The innate immune response is an immediate and non-specific response against pathogens, acting swiftly to prevent the spread of infections. The primary cells involved in this response are phagocytes and natural killer (NK) cells.

Immune surveillance is an integral part of the innate immune system, involving the continuous monitoring of peripheral tissues to detect and respond to pathogens, infected cells, or cancerous cells. This surveillance is conducted primarily by natural killer (NK) cells and phagocytes, which employ distinct but complementary mechanisms to identify and eliminate threats.

The stem cell niche is the dynamic microenvironment where stem cells reside. Inside these niches, the cells may remain undifferentiated, undergo high self-renewal, or become lineage-specific progenitors. Stem cells coexist with other niche cells, such as stromal cells. They also interact closely with the ECM. Cell-cell and cell-matrix communication occur via adhesion molecules or soluble factors that signal the stem cells and determine their fate.
